Developer’s Checklist: No-Code vs. Code
The No-Code vs. Code debate has long stirred opinions in the developer community—often with no-code dismissed as a toy, a threat, or “not real programming.” But what if that mindset is actually slowing you down?
In today’s fast-paced digital landscape, the real question isn’t No-Code vs. Code—it’s about knowing when to use what and how combining both can make you a smarter, more efficient builder. This guide will help shift your mindset and provide a practical framework for making smarter development choices.
1. Mindset Shift: No-Code Isn’t a Threat, It’s an Enhancement
Let’s address the elephant in the room: resistance. Many developers worry that no-code “cheapens” their hard-earned skills. This couldn’t be further from the truth
Using no-code doesn’t make you less of a developer. It makes you a smarter one.
Think of no-code as a strategic tool in your development arsenal. It helps you:
- Prototype rapidly
- Collaborate better with non-tech teams
- Free up time for complex logic and custom features
The No-Code vs. Code debate isn’t about replacement—it’s about hybrid development. Blend both to build smarter and faster.
👉 Looking to build a product fast or need expert guidance? Get in touch and let’s chat.
2. When to Use Code vs. No-Code: Typical Project Scenarios
Here’s a practical breakdown of common project types and which approach fits better:
Scenario | No-Code Approach | Code Approach |
MVP/prototype in 1 week | ✅ Fast & efficient | ❌ Too slow |
Custom algorithm or logic-heavy app | ❌ Limited | ✅ Needed |
Admin dashboard or internal tools | ✅ Tools like Retool | ✅ Possible, but slower |
Full-featured mobile app | ❌ Limited | ✅ Needed |
Website + CMS for client | ✅ Webflow, Framer | ✅ React/Next.js possible |
Scalable SaaS with auth, roles | ⚠️ Bubble possible but brittle | ✅ Full control |
3. No-Code ≠ No Power — Here’s the Real Comparison
Let’s compare popular no-code tools with their coded counterparts to highlight capabilities.
Category | No-Code Tool Example | Code Equivalent |
Mobile Apps | FlutterFlow, Adalo | Flutter, React Native |
Web Apps | Bubble, Webflow | Next.js, Django |
Backend | Xano, Supabase (semi-code) | Node.js, Django REST, Go |
DB/Storage | Airtable, Google Sheets | PostgreSQL, MySQL, MongoDB |
Automations | Zapier, Make | Python scripts, CRON jobs |
Auth | Glide Auth, Xano Auth | Firebase Auth, JWT |
Dashboards | Retool, Softr | Custom React Dashboard |
As you can see, no-code tools pack real power. The key difference is speed, customizability, and control.
4. How Code & No-Code Can Coexist
The most efficient strategy isn’t choosing sides—it’s combining both:
👉 No-Code Frontend + Coded Backend
Build a slick UI using Bubble/Webflow, then connect it to a coded backend (Node.js, Supabase).
👉 Zapier/Make Automations + Coded Services
Use no-code automation to trigger workflows between your APIs and third-party tools.
👉 No-Code for MVP, Code for Scale
Validate with no-code. Scale with code.
👉 Retool for Internal Tools
Build internal dashboards in hours, not days—hook into your APIs securely.

✅ Want a hybrid solution built by a pro? Let’s partner up for your next product.
5. Decision Checklist: When to Use No-Code vs. Code

Ask yourself:
- Is this primarily an MVP or internal tool?
- Do I need to ship within a week?
- Is complex business logic involved?
- Will this app be maintained by developers long-term?
- Do I need pixel-perfect custom design?
- Can I leverage existing templates/components?
The Verdict
✅ Mostly “Yes” to MVP, speed, or templates? Use No-Code.
✅ Mostly “Yes” to logic, scale, or customization? Use Code.
Final Thoughts
The No-Code vs. Code debate is no longer about which is better—it’s about how to strategically leverage both to build smarter, faster, and more efficiently. The software landscape is evolving rapidly, and today’s most effective developers are not just coders—they’re problem solvers, product thinkers, and system designers.
By understanding when to use no-code tools to move quickly—and when to lean into custom code for scalability and control—you position yourself as a modern builder who delivers results, not just code.
If you’re building MVPs, internal tools, or early-stage products, no-code tools give you speed without sacrificing functionality. When your product matures and needs deeper integrations or complex logic, code gives you the flexibility and long-term control required to scale.
💡 In short, “No-Code vs. Code” isn’t a battle. It’s a toolkit.
🔍 Curious how no-code can fit into your dev stack? Or when to switch gears and go full-code?
👉 Explore a custom solution — book a free consult today.